FAQ: What happens if the pin-lock manifest for Ironmoor gets corrupted?

Our dependency pinning policy requires every Ironmoor service to ship with a signed pin-lock manifest. If the manifest is corrupted or the signing check fails in CI, builds halt — that's intentional. Future maintainers should regenerate the manifest from the last good snapshot in the policy vault, then re-sign it. Opening the policy vault requires the recovery passphrase, which follows.

unlock words, hahip-baduf: holwyn-istath-julvan

## Circuit Breaker Environment Variables

The Tallowfen gateway wraps calls to the upstream Quarrel pricing API in a circuit breaker. `BREAKER_FAILURE_THRESHOLD` (default 5) and `BREAKER_RESET_SECONDS` (default 30) control tripping and recovery; `BREAKER_HALF_OPEN_PROBES` sets how many trial requests run after reset. When the breaker is open, the gateway serves cached quotes, which requires authenticated reads from the quote cache. For that to work in each environment, the env file must also contain the following line.

secret setting of yajog-taguf: ARCHIVE_KEY3=051

Finance Review Summary — Revised Commission Scheme

Following the Q3 review, Marlowe & Vance Ltd will move sales commissions from a flat 4% to a tiered structure: 3% on the first tranche, 6% above target, effective next quarter. Modelling by Priya Onslow suggests a modest uplift in payout costs offset by stronger pipeline conversion. Sales leads should note the strategic context below.

board note of kageg-bahof: The renewal with Holwynax Holdings closes at $2 million a year, 5 percent below the last contract. Project Ulaath slips by two quarters because of the supplier delay.

Facilities Ticket — Cleaning Crew Access, Brindle Annex

For new starters handling evening lock-up: the Sorano Cleaning crew arrives nightly at 21:30 via the annex side door. Check their rota sheet, note arrival in the log, and ensure the storeroom is relocked afterward. To let them through the side door, enter the access code below.

badge for yaweg-hafog: bdg-GX-6